Scotia Homes joins Northsound 1’s Mission Christmas 2025 appeal

14th Nov, 2025

Scotia Homes is proud to once again support Cash for Kids’ Mission Christmas campaign, helping make sure children across Aberdeen and the North East wake up to a gift on Christmas morning. Run in partnership with Northsound 1, Mission Christmas is the region’s biggest festive toy appeal, supporting thousands of local children who might otherwise receive nothing on the big day.

This year, Scotia Homes will be hosting a Mission Christmas drop-off point at our new showhome at Park View in Kintore. The showhome is open Thursday to Monday, 10.30am–5pm, giving plenty of opportunity for people to stop by with a donation.

Mission Christmas supports children and young people who are affected by poverty, illness, neglect or have additional needs. Working with local organisations, schools, social workers and community groups, Cash for Kids ensures gifts reach families who need them most across Aberdeen and the North East. In recent years, the appeal has provided presents for thousands of local children, with demand continuing to rise as the cost of living impacts more households.

We are inviting customers, residents and the wider community to donate new, unwrapped gifts suitable for children and teenagers up to 18. Popular ideas include toys, books, games, arts and crafts, warm clothing and accessories, toiletries sets and age-appropriate tech or vouchers for older children. Every single gift – big or small – helps bring a little excitement, dignity and joy to Christmas morning for a local child.

If you’re visiting the Park View showhome to explore a new home, dropping in to see friends nearby or passing through Kintore, we would love you to consider bringing an extra gift along for the Mission Christmas box. Together with Northsound 1 and Cash for Kids, we can make a real difference for families in our communities this festive season.
